Today I wanted to share with you a day I spent in early October at St Mary’s Bay, a hidden beach in Devon. I had recently bought a Fedora from Zara and was itching to style it, for I feel it brings an outfit together and underlines the real completion of your outfit.
I used to be shy about wearing hats, as it can be identified as quite a statement!
The question, should I wear a hat? do they suit me? was continuously revolving in my mind, for if I was to wear it wrong, I could be perceived as someone that just wasn't me!
I came to the conclusion that one is truly dressed when wearing a hat! Although it is, indeed a statement, if you want to wear it and it suits your mood then just do it! Wearing a hat is one of the best ways to portray your personality, often a lot more than clothes, for as Christian Dior stated, ‘ a hat is the quintessence of femininity with all the frivolity this world contains!’
Below are photographs of the 5 outfits I styled around this Fedora, transitioning some summer looks to more Autumnal ones.
